Key Insights
The fluorinated polyimide market is experiencing robust growth, projected to maintain a Compound Annual Growth Rate (CAGR) exceeding 30% from 2025 to 2033. This expansion is driven by the increasing demand for high-performance materials in various sectors, including aerospace, electronics, and automotive. The inherent properties of fluorinated polyimides, such as exceptional thermal stability, chemical resistance, and dielectric strength, make them crucial components in advanced technologies. Specifically, their application in flexible printed circuit boards (FPCBs) for high-frequency electronics and demanding aerospace environments fuels market growth. Further advancements in material science, leading to improved processability and enhanced performance characteristics, contribute to the market's upward trajectory. The rising adoption of electric vehicles and the proliferation of 5G technology are also significant growth catalysts, demanding lightweight yet robust materials with high dielectric properties. Major players like DuPont, Daikin Industries, and Sumitomo Chemical are driving innovation and expansion through research and development, strategic partnerships, and capacity expansion.

Fluorinated Polyimide Industry Product Developments
Recent product developments focus on enhancing the existing properties of fluorinated polyimides like improved flexibility, higher temperature resistance, and enhanced dielectric strength. These innovations are driving new applications in flexible electronics, high-frequency circuit boards, and advanced packaging solutions, improving performance and reducing product size and weight. Companies are also exploring bio-based fluorinated polyimide options to address environmental concerns.

Key Milestones in Fluorinated Polyimide Industry
- April 2021: Kolon Industries announced supplying its proprietary colorless polyimide film for Lenovo's ThinkPad X1 Fold, the world's first foldable PC. This highlighted the growing demand for flexible polyimides in innovative consumer electronics.
